NIGERIA PESTEL ANALYSIS



Nigeria map


PESTEL
is an analytical tool used to find facts in in existing business or yet to start business to give fact about the business and to know how to improve.

  Political: Nigeria practice Democratic system of government with multiple party system,the executive can only be voted into the same office twice and each tenure lasts for four(4) years after which the same leader will nolonger be eligible to contest for that same position. in the past and currently Nigeria like any other country faces strong political tussle but that gives her democracy opportunity to grow.

Economical: Nigeria economy can never be neglected despite the economic crisis she is facing in the last few years. It used to be best in West Africa due to its petroleum business and other natural resources.  With the emergence of electric cars Nigeria economy is sure threatened but it could diversify her economy to help withstand the challenges. Nigeria as a country is the biggest market in Africa due to her population. 

Social: Nigeria Society is a masculine society in which everyone want to succeed with little or no care on how others feel except their immediate family member, people try to be successful in a career or a particular discipline just to make their parents or family feel good.Nigeria society is a delicate one and has diverse ethnic groups with diverse culture and values.

The three(3) major ethnic groups in Nigeria and their traditional Dressing 





Technological: Nigeria as a developing country is gradually becoming technologically sofisticated as it continuously adopt every trending Technology. But the percentage that is technically sofisticated are few as the literate level of Nigerians is still not too high. The most interesting thing about Nigerians is their potency to adopt and adapt to every trending Technology and their behaviour of embracing foreign products more than local products.

Ethical: Ethically Nigerians can be grouped into tribe, religion and political views, These things determines peoples' principles and values.This is one of the most delicate part of Nigerians.

Legal:Nigeria legal system is a world class legal system though sometimes the executive have influence on them because the Attorney general and chief Justice of the federation is to be appointed by the executive. Nigerians enjoy freedom of speech and the Judiciary has the power to impeach the executives.

GLOBAL WARMING 



Global warming is an aspect of climate change, referring to the long-term rise of the planet's temperatures. It is caused by increased concentrations of greenhouse gases in the atmosphere, It is also a gradual increase in the overall temperature of the earths atmosphere generally attributed to the greenhouse, effect causes by increased level of carbon dioxide, CFcs(Chlorofluorocarbons), and other pollutants. Global warming is the long-term heating of Earth’s climate system observed since the pre-industrial period (between 1850 and 1900) due to human activities, primarily fossil fuel burning, which increases heat-trapping greenhouse gas levels in Earth’s atmosphere. 






CAUSES OF GLOBAL WARMING 

The Greenhouse Effect: Is a natural process that warms the earth’s surface. When the sun’s energy reaches the earth’s atmosphere, some of it is reflected back to space and the rest is absorbed and re-radiated by greenhouse gases these gases could be water vapor, carbon dioxide, nitrous oxide, ozone etc. 



The Influence of Human Activity on Climate: human activity has influenced global surface temperatures by changing the radioactive balance governing the earth on various timescales and at varying spatial scales. The most profound and well known anthropogenic influence is the elevation of concentrations of greenhouse gases in the atmosphere. Humans also influence climate by changing the concentrations of aerosols and Ozone and by modifying the land cover of Earth’s surface. Increase in Average Temperature and Temperature Extremes: one of the most immediate and obvious effects of global warming is the increase in temperatures around the world. The average global temperature has increase by about 1.4 degree Fahrenheit (0.8) degrees Celsius) over the past 100 years, according to the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ration (NOAA).

DISEASES affecting human


 DISEASES 

Disease can be seen as any harmful deviation from the normal structural or functional state of an organism, generally associated with certain signs and symptoms and differing in nature from physical injury. 

A disease is a particular abnormal condition that negatively affects the structure or function of all or part of an organism, and that is not due to any immediate external injury (White, 2014)

 disease may be caused by external factors such as pathogens or by internal dysfunctions. For example, internal dysfunctions of the immune system can produce a variety of different diseases, including various forms of immunodeficiency, hypersensitivity, allergies and autoimmune disorders. According to WHO, there four major types of diseases which are : infectious diseases deficiency diseases hereditary diseases (including both genetic diseases and non-genetic hereditary diseases), physiological diseases. Diseases can also be classified in other ways, such as communicable versus non-communicable diseases. Examples of Diseases:

Malaria : Is a life-threatening disease caused by parasites that are transmitted to people through the bites of infected female Anopheles mosquitoes. It is caused by Plasmodium parasites. The parasites are spread to people through the bites of infected female Anopheles mosquitoes, called "malaria vectors. Malaria is preventable and curable. 

In 2019, there were an estimated 229 million cases of malaria worldwide. And the estimated number of malaria deaths stood at 409 000 in 2019.

 Children aged under 5 years are the most vulnerable group affected by malaria; in 2019, they accounted for 67% (274 000) of all malaria deaths worldwide. 

Malaria causes so much illness and death, the disease is a great drain on many national economies. Since many countries with malaria are already among the poorer nations, the disease maintains a vicious cycle of disease and poverty. 

 Kinds of malaria parasite:  Five species of Plasmodium (single-celled parasites) can infect humans and cause illness: 

1. Plasmodium falciparum (or P. falciparum)



 






2. Plasmodium malariae (or P. malariae) 









3. Plasmodium vivax (or P. vivax) 













4. Plasmodium ovale (or P. ovale) 








5. Plasmodium knowlesi (or P. knowlesi) 










 THE FIVE SPECIES OF MALARIA CAUSING ORGANISM 











Two of these species- P. falciparum and P. vivax pose the greatest threat. They are likely to result in severe infections and if not promptly treated, may lead to death. Although malaria can be a deadly disease, illness and death from malaria can usually be prevented. 

 Symptoms of  Malaria is an acute febrile illness. In a non-immune individual, symptoms usually appear 10–15 days after the infective mosquito bite. 

Symptoms are; pain in the muscles or abdomen, fever, chills, fatigue, malaise, shivering, sweating, nausea, vomiting, headache, fast heart rate or pallor. The first symptoms are fever, headache and chills. 

Malaria may become mild and difficult to recognize as malaria, if not treated within 24 hours. P.falciparum malaria can progress to severe illness, often leading to death. 

Children with severe malaria frequently develop one or more of the following symptoms: severe anaemia, respiratory distress in relation to metabolic acidosis, or cerebral malaria. 

Malaria is a global pandemic, Presently, it is more prevalent in developing nations which includes Nigeria. Although the government of Nigeria and World health Organisation is fighting it with every applicable means.

Carnivorous plants


 CAN PLANT TRAP AND FEED ON ANIMALS?

This sounds strange but science has some plants  grouped as carnivorous plants due to their ability to trap and feed(digest) on animals or plants as their  source of nutrition. Some of the plants includes 

1. Pitcher plant 

2. Mistletoe 

3. Venus fly trap


PITCHER PLANT 

This is a name used for a group of carnivorous plants that has similar leave modification for trapping insects , this type of modified leaves Is known as pitfall traps.

These plants according to Biology/Botany are in the family  nepenthaceae  and sarraceniaceae.

MISTLETOE 

This is a parasitic plant  which attach itself on its host with its specialised adaptative feature  called  Haustorium. They use the Haustorium to extract water and nutrients from their host plant.

VENUS FLY TRAP 

Venus flytrap is a carnivorous plant that feed on flies. It's opens its red coloured part that is very attractive to flies , This red part of Venus fly trap is steaky, with sensitive hairs and highly saturated with digestive enzymes.  When flies perch on it they got stuck by the steaky environment while the flower close covering the fly  and digestive enzymes are secreted to digest the flies.

Why Nigeria is every investor's concern.

The major challenges Investors have to face is Ethnic/tribal crisis and political Crisis.

Because Nigeria is made up of  people with different cultural values, beliefs from the southern and northern part of Nigeria; It is very important that the potential investors need to study the human behavior in each region if not every state; it is vital as it can

help the investors in deciding market targets, Marketing communication type and strategy.
